Final Advice for the New Explorer
- Sub vs. Dub? Both are valid. Modern dubs (like Cyberpunk: Edgerunners or Kaguya-sama) are excellent. Pick whichever lets you enjoy the story best.
- Start Short. Don’t start with One Piece. Try a 12-episode gem like Erased (time travel mystery) or Death Note (cat-and-mouse thriller).
- Manga reads "backwards." Remember to read the panels from right to left. It takes 10 minutes to get used to.

7. Recommendation Table by Viewer Profile
| Viewer Type | Best Anime Starter | Best Manga Starter |
|-------------|--------------------|--------------------|
| Loves action & big fights | Demon Slayer | One Piece (first 3 vols) |
| Loves complex stories & twists | Attack on Titan | Death Note |
| Loves romance & crying | Your Lie in April (anime) | Fruits Basket |
| Prefers short, complete stories (under 30 eps) | Erased | Goodnight Punpun (caution) |
| Wants ongoing weekly conversation | Jujutsu Kaisen / Spy x Family | Chainsaw Man (part 2) |
- Attack on Titan - A dark fantasy series set in a world where humans are under attack by giant humanoid creatures.
- Naruto - A long-running ninja-themed anime with a rich storyline, lovable characters, and epic battles.
- One Piece - A classic adventure anime that follows Monkey D. Luffy and his crew as they search for the ultimate treasure, the One Piece.
- Death Note - A psychological thriller that revolves around a high school student who discovers a notebook that can kill anyone whose name is written in it.
- Fullmetal Alchemist: Brotherhood - A fantasy adventure series that follows two brothers on a quest to restore their bodies after a failed attempt to bring their mother back to life using alchemy.
- Your Lie in April - A beautiful coming-of-age story that explores the intersection of music, love, and loss.
- Haikyuu!! - A sports anime that follows a high school volleyball team's journey to the top.
- My Hero Academia - A superhero anime set in a world where superpowers are the norm, and a young boy dreams of becoming a hero.
- Sword Art Online - A sci-fi anime that explores the concept of virtual reality gaming and the psychological effects it has on players.
- Demon Slayer: Kimetsu no Yaiba - A dark fantasy series that follows a young boy who becomes a demon slayer after his family is slaughtered by demons.
